Transaction 21d5c3ddd777239f3253887c6ad0b2bf7a1798696c466a5c55cc0491ac87d78e

1 Input
1 Outputs
  • 21d5c3ddd777239f3253887c6ad0b2bf7a1798696c466a5c55cc0491ac87d78e:0
  • value  5927700
    address  1L5bE4EXcgJ9dTwDTsZw28dwNnHEKvAn3c